OFG’s Oriental Introduces Next Generation ATMs

OFG Bancorp’s (NYSE:OFG) Oriental Bank subsidiary has begun to introduce a next generation of ATMs incorporating two-way, real-time audio-video communication with live tellers. Oriental’s video interactive ATMs continue to strengthen the bank’s leadership in providing new service channels, employing state of the art banking technology for increased customer convenience.

“Video ATMs are the latest capital investments being made by Oriental to offer new and different customer solutions as another way to help Puerto Rico’s recovery,” said Ganesh Kumar, Senior Executive Vice President and Chief Operating Officer of OFG Bancorp. “We can’t let the hurricanes stop us. We have to forge ahead to help customers get on with their lives and help the economy get moving again.”

Through audio and video between customers and remote tellers, Oriental’s new ATMs offer the ability to make payments on loans, cards or utilities; deposit and withdraw money; and transfer money and cash checks through scanners and signature pads.

"People want banks to make their lives easier,” said Debbie Sabater, Oriental’s Senior Vice President of Retail Strategy. “Our Video ATMs provide easy and convenient access to ATM banking services with the added benefit of a personal interaction of a teller at the touch of a button.”

The first Oriental Video ATMs in operation are located at the Plaza Las Américas branch. They are available Monday through Friday from 9:00 am to 6:00 pm and Saturdays from 9:00 am to 3:00 pm. Video ATMs are also available at the drive through lane at the Caguas Bairoa branch from Monday to Friday from 8:30 am to 6:00 pm and Saturdays from 9:00 am to 3:00 pm.

"This is the beginning of Oriental’s roll out of Video ATMs in other locations,” Sabater added. “It is a new way of replicating our banking services to strategically expand our presence on the island.”

In the past three years, Oriental has pioneered “first in Puerto Rico” banking services such as FOTODepósito, People Pay, Oriental Biz and Cardless Cash, with the aim of streamlining transactions and increasing convenience for individual and commercial customers.

About OFG Bancorp

Now in its 53rd year in business, OFG Bancorp is a diversified financial holding company that operates under U.S. and Puerto Rico banking laws and regulations. Its three principal subsidiaries, Oriental Bank, Oriental Financial Services and Oriental Insurance, provide a wide range of retail and commercial banking, lending and wealth management products, services and technology, primarily in Puerto Rico, through 48 financial centers.
